Iterative Simulation Testing, within the context of cryptocurrency derivatives, options trading, and financial derivatives, represents a crucial methodology for assessing trading strategy robustness and risk exposure. It involves repeatedly executing a trading strategy across a range of simulated market conditions, progressively refining the strategy based on observed performance metrics. This process allows for the identification of vulnerabilities and opportunities that might not be apparent through traditional backtesting approaches, particularly in volatile and rapidly evolving crypto markets. The core objective is to build confidence in a strategy’s resilience and adaptability before deploying it with real capital.
